5-day industrial exhibition begins
Chakwal Chamber of Commerce, Industry president gets Romania govt award
From Our Correspondent
CHAKWAL: A five-day industrial exhibition arranged by Chakwal Chamber of Commerce and Industry with the collaboration of the district government of Chakwal started on Wednesday.
The inaugural ceremony was presided over by former federal minster Lt-Gen (retd) Abdul Majeed Malik and Romanian Ambassador Eliman was the chief guest.
Chaudhry Sultan Haider, Abdul Razzaq Jami, MPAs Sardar Zulfiqar Dullaha, Mevish Sultana, Malik Aslam Seethi, Chaudhry Shehzad Saadat and Zafar Bakhtawari, ex president Islamabad chamber of commerce spoke on the occasion.
The welcome address was presented by President Chakwal Chamber of Commerce and Industry Qazi Mohammad Akbar, who was confident that the industrial zone announced by PM Nawaz Sharif on motorway would be established at newly approved Neela interchange.
Eliman said there was a good scope of investment between Pakistan and Romania and was confident that mutual business transaction would be strengthened in near future.
An award from the Romania government was also presented by Eliman to Chakwal Chamber of Commerce and Industry president Qazi Mohammad Akbar for his services rendered in industrial and social sector.
The exhibition will continue until April 12th.
DCO Mehmood Jawaid Bhatti, DPO Dr Moeen Masood, AC Chakwal Musawar Khan Niazi, District Monitoring Officer Asif Iqbal Chohan were also present.
